"I don’t love being in front of the camera. Most photographers don’t. Yet I leave traces—reflections in gallery windows, warped shadows in mirrors, fragments of myself tucked into the corners of other people’s stories. These images are not portraits. They’re proof I was there: a presence glimpsed in glass, multiplied in mirrors, fractured and reassembled, echoing in places where absence might otherwise erase me.” - Ed Hineline
